How much do electronics engineer no experience j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for electronics engineer no experience in the United States is $88,896.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$59,500.00 and $109,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Electronics Engineer No Experience position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Electronics Engineer with no prior experience, you should possess a solid understanding of electronic circuits, basic programming, and a degree in electrical or electronics engineering. Familiarity with simulation tools like MATLAB or LTSpice, PCB design software such as Altium Designer, and an understanding of industry standards are advantageous.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ills will help you contribute to team projects and solve technical problems. These skills ensure you can effectively assist with design, troubleshooting, and documentation while learning and growing in a professional engineering environment.

What types of projects or responsibilities can I expect as an entry-level Electronics Engineer with no experience?

As an entry-level Electronics Engineer, you will typically support senior engineers with tasks such as schematic design, circuit testing, and documentation of design processes. You might also assist in assembling prototypes, conducting experiments, and analyzing test results. Collaboration is common—expect to work closely with cross-functional teams, including mechanical engineers and software developers, to develop or refine products. These early responsibilities are designed to help you build hands-on experience, gradually increase your technical proficiency, and prepare you for more complex projects down the line.

What is an Electronics Engineer No Experience job?

An Electronics Engineer No Experience job is an entry-level position for individuals with a degree in electronics engineering but little to no professional experience. These roles often involve assisting senior engineers, conducting research, testing circuits, and troubleshooting electronic systems. Employers typically look for strong theoretical knowledge, problem-solving skills, and a willingness to learn. Many companies provide on-the-job training to help new engineers develop practical skills. This role serves as a foundation for career growth in electronics engineering.

Job description

As Electronics Engineer your main responsibilities will include
Establish client requirements for the Subsea Electronic Modules (SEM) from specification.
Incorporate these requirements into either generic drawing set or create a new General Assembly with associated drawings and documentation using AutoCAD and Word format documents.
Support the build of the SEM or other electronic based equipment through manufacturing as required.
Support the SEM or other electronic based equipment during Factory Integration Testing (FIT) and Factory Assembly Testing (FAT).
The development, test and maintenance of hardware related work scope within the Project Development, or Project Support Groups.
Assist in the mentoring and development of graduate and subordinate engineers to improve quality awareness and experience of systems in use within the company.
Assisting Senior Electronic Engineer with development and improvement of quality procedures.
Monitoring areas of work allocated and reporting current status, estimates to complete, and resource requirements to Work Package Manager and Senior Electronic Engineer
